4In the IPv4 Destination List or the IPv6 Destination List, do the following for the Destination Number to configure the IPv4 or IPv6 SNMP alert destination:

a Select or clear the State checkbox. A selected checkbox indicates that the IP address is enabled to receive the alerts. A clear checkbox indicates that the IP address is disabled for receiving alerts.

b In Destination IPv4 Address or Destination IPv6 Address, enter a valid platform event trap destination IP address.

c In Test Trap, click Send to test the configured alert.

NOTE: Your user account must have Test Alerts permission to send a test trap. See Table 6-6 for more information.

The changes you specified are displayed in either the IPv4 or IPv6 Destination List.

5In the Community String field, enter the iDRAC SNMP community name.

NOTE: The destination community string must be the same as the iDRAC6 community string.

6Click Apply. The settings are saved.

NOTE: If you disable a Platform Event Filter, the trap associated with that sensor going "bad" is also disabled. Traps associated with "bad to good" transitions are always generated, if the Enable Platform Event Filter Alerts option is enabled. For example, if you disable the Generate Alert option for the Removebale Flash MEdia Informational Assert Filter and remove the SD card, the associated trap is not displayed. The trap is generated if you insert the SD card again. But if you enable the Platform Event Filter, a trap is generated when you remove or insert the SD card.

Configuring E-Mail Alerts

NOTE: If your mail server is Microsoft Exchange Server 2007, ensure that iDRAC domain name is configured for the mail server to receive the email alerts from iDRAC.

NOTE: E-mail alerts support both IPv4 and IPv6 addresses.

1Log in to the remote system using a supported Web browser.

2Ensure that you have performed the procedures in "Configuring Platform Event Filters (PEF)" on page 59.
